Package: libpoppler-glib3 Version: 0.8.7-1 Severity: normal
Hi, a user on #debian-security ("schmidt") reported that the pdf linked from this page http://de.wikipedia.org/wiki/Bild:WikiReader_Digest_2005-17.pdf uses all memory when nautilus tries to create the thumbnail via evince-thumbnailer (which in turn uses poppler). I killed evince when it grew over 2GB mem usage. Acroread and gv can display the file with about 100-150MB mem usage.
